When did New Hampshire become part of the US?

Best Answer

On 21 June 1788 it became the 9th US State.

How and when did New Hampshire become a state?

New Hampshire became a state in 1788 when it ratified the US Constitution. It was one of the original thirteen colonies that came the first states.
